Notes:
I begin the pattern at the top of the toe box. The short row is turning for the toe, and then knit until the heel.

If you need to add length for a different foot size, I followed this formula:

(x-32).5 = number of stitches to pick up on either side

x=number of total rows knit for the sole.

Size 7 should be: 24 stitches (80 rows total)
Size 8 should be: 26 stitches (84 rows total)
Size 9 should be: 38 stitches (88 rows total)
Size 10 should be: 30 stitches (92 rows total)
Size 11 should be: 32 stitches (96 rows total)
Size 12 should be: 34 stitches (100 rows total)
Size 13 should be: 36 stitches (104 rows total)
